Transaction 89361323827dd98c57d2c7396d7499330166e62abc50773d52794c81b940a737

1 Input
2 Outputs
  • 89361323827dd98c57d2c7396d7499330166e62abc50773d52794c81b940a737:0
  • value  142542653
    address  17FpkMyATxXKMxwCCRPubQKgracN3xbkn7
  • 89361323827dd98c57d2c7396d7499330166e62abc50773d52794c81b940a737:1
  • value  38451108
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n